MHO distance relays are used to protect andÊdetect faults and the location of faults on a transmission line. It detects faults by measuring and comparing phase angles through a phase comparator.

No. Your terminology is close but not quite right. The three main types of faults are normal faults, reverse faults, and strike-slip faults. Strike-slip faults may also be called transform faults.
